THE SHORT ANSWER
Being included in someone's real life often shows growing comfort and seriousness. The signal is strongest when the inclusion is natural, repeated, and not kept secret. In this case, a public-private behavior gap is a positive signal only when the rest of his behavior is clear, respectful, and consistent.

WHAT NOT TO ASSUME
One moment is not the whole relationship.
One introduction does not define the relationship. Watch whether social inclusion expands or was a one-off convenience.
